Description

Stillman College invites applications for a full-time nine-month faculty position in Supply Chain Management within the School of Business beginning Fall 2026 (or as negotiated). We seek a
dynamic student-centered faculty member committed to excellence in teaching scholarship and service.



Job Responsibilities

Primary Responsibilities

  • Teach undergraduate courses in Supply Chain Management Logistics Operations Management Procurement and related business courses
  • Advise mentor and support Supply Chain Management majors and students pursuing business pathways
  • Collaborate in curriculum development to advance a modern and industry-relevant Supply Chain program
  • Engage in assessment and accreditation efforts consistent with IACBE standards
  • Participate in School of Business committees faculty meetings student recruitment and community outreach
  • Maintain ongoing scholarly and/or professional engagement in the discipline
  • Contribute to service activities supporting Stillman Colleges mission and strategic priorities

Minimum Qualifications

  • Masters degree in Supply Chain Management Logistics Operations Management Business Administration or a closely related field
  • Significant professional experience in supply chain logistics procurement or operations management
  • Demonstrated commitment to teaching and supporting diverse student populations

Preferred Qualifications

  • Doctorate in Supply Chain Management Logistics Operations Business or related field (completed or ABD)
  • Industry-recognized certifications (e.g. APICS/ASCM CPSM CPIM CLTD PMP Lean Six Sigma)
  • College-level teaching experience (face-to-face and/or online)
  • Evidence of scholarly engagement (research publications presentations or applied practice)
